Address

ecash:pq9xa38d8p878z9d4mpw832lprka5pv9ecnmy0tj09Copy

Total Received

840.33 XEC

Total Sent

840.33 XEC

№ Transactions

8

Final Balance

0 XEC

Transactions
Filter